John P. Larkin Country Club

1571 Route 5 North, Windsor, Vermont, 5089

John P. Larkin Country Club Deals

Combo Days
Valid ∞
$35
Cart Incl.

Deal Details

Golf Pass Region

John P. Larkin Country Club is available in the Northeast Golf Pass and Super Pass

Map Location

John P. Larkin Country Club details

John P. Larkin Country Club is a beautiful 9 hole golf course located in Windsor, Vermont. So, if you are a golfer that wants a GOOD challenge, OR you just want to have FUN come play a round!

Northeast Golf Pass

Buy Now

Tommy Fleetwood has been heating up this season, and while he still hasn’t notched a PGA TOUR win, his ball striking is turning heads. This week, Darren deMaille from Quick Fix Golf breaks down one of the drills Fleetwood relies on to stay sharp—and it’s a powerful 4-in-1 station that can improve nearly every part of your swing.

How to Set It Up:

Alignment stick on the ground: Helps guide your target line.

Alignment stick angled in the ground: Matches your club’s natural plane.

Obstacle (foam